I bought these for a hike to Hemphill Bald in NC. I have 4 other pairs of Hoka shoes and getting a size 12.5 fits perfectly, however in these hiking shoes I think because they are Gortex and waterproof I would recommend getting them one-half size larger. Plus hiking 9 or 10 miles your feet are sure to swell so getting them a half size larger will help there as well. I recommend these for comfort and traction and for being relatively light for a hiking shoe. I would definitely buy these again, just a half size larger.

Bought to wear as hiking shoes on primitive rocky trails in Lakeway, TX. Much more stable with significant improvement in down hill traction, noticed immediately, than the running shoes I had been wearing. Goretex did make them a bit hot on 100 degree days. As weather has cooled to 80s, seem OK. Very comfortable and absorb rocks and roots with no discomfort. Have had about a month and see no signs of wear so far.
